London: Victor Gollancz LTD, 1962. First Edition. Near Fine/Very Good+. First British edition and first hardcover edition; first printing. Signed by J.G. Ballard on the title page. Bound in publisher's rust-colored cloth lettered in gilt. Near Fine with slight lean to binding, light wear to spine ends. Top edge lightly foxed, contents lightly tanned. In a Very Good+ unclipped dust jacket with light toning and small stain to spine, small tears at edges and front flap; larger tear at front joint, minor soiling. The author's second novel, though he later disowned his first as "hackwork.

About The Drowned World

Set in a post-apocalyptic world where solar radiation has melted the ice caps, ‘The Drowned World’ explores the effects of climate change on the Earth and its remaining inhabitants. The novel follows the protagonist, Dr. Robert Kerans, as he and his companions navigate the flooded cities of the former civilization.
